Which Automation Testing Tool Will Be In Demand In 2023?

Automation Testing
Automation Testing

The future of automation testing is encouraging and will continue to evolve and improve over the following years.

There is a steady increase in the software development activities carried out by organizations. Hence, organizations look for two factors in particular while carrying out the software development and testing works: maintaining high quality and speed of execution. Automation testing is an efficient platform that has benefitted organizations by scaling up the productivity of testing works. For apt usage of automation, software testing automation tools are required.

A test automation framework ensures that the entire test automation process is carried out in a structured and streamlined manner. In this article, you will learn about test automation tools that will have considerable demand in 2023.

Following are the in-demand software testing automation tools in 2023 to choose from:

  1. Katalon Studio: It is a low-code scalable automation testing tool for testing mobile, desktop, and API applications. Based on research, there are over a million users in the Katalon community. The numbers clearly show the prominence of this tool. The coding requirements are removed, and the test automation framework is built from scratch. Users can download the tool and focus on testing.
  2. Tricentis Tosca: It is a comprehensive automation tool for desktop, mobile, and API testing. It has a model-based testing approach through which users can scan APIs or application’s UI to develop a business-familiar model for test maintenance and creation. It provides risk-based test optimization with requirement prioritization and innovative test design.
  3. Selenium: It is one of the most popular open-source test automation frameworks for web testing. The “Selenium suite” consists of four tools, namely Selenium IDE (Integrated Development Environment), Selenium WebDriver, Selenium RC (Remote Control), and Selenium Grid. It supports popular programming languages such as PHP, Ruby, Perl, C#, Python, JavaScript etc.
  4. Appium: It is an open-source software testing automation tool exclusively used for testing mobile applications. The Mobile JSON wire protocol is used so that users can write automated UI tests for hybrid mobile, web-based and native applications on both Android and iOS. It provides cross-platform testing with the same APIs and reusable test scripts. It can efficiently execute across emulators, simulators, and real devices.
  5. Apache JMeter: It is an open-source tool designed for performing automated performance testing on web applications. A heavy load of users can be stimulated to analyze the AUT’s performance and access web services. It can also be used for functional API testing. It has a user-friendly interface and can be easily integrated with CI/CD tools.
  6. Ranorex Studio: This tool can automate GUI testing for desktop, mobile, and web applications. It is equipped with both full IDE and low-code automation. It provides broad support for desktop, mobile, and web technologies. For reliable recognition of GUI elements, RanoreXPath and Ranorex Spy tools are used. This tool provides a platform where parallel or distributed testing can be done with Selenium Grid.
  7. Protractor: It is an open-source test automation framework that automates end-to-end testing for Angular and Angular JS applications. It works as an integrator of NodeJS, Jasmine, Selenium WebDriver, and other technologies. It also supports behavior-driven development frameworks like Mocha and Jasmine. Native events are used for carrying out test execution in a real browser. This tool can efficiently work for regression testing with non-Angular apps.
  8. IBM Rational Functional Tester (RFT): As the name says, it is a commercial testing tool introduced by IBM and helps create regression or functional test cases. It supports data-driven testing, GUI testing, and more. Tests can be seen and edited by the storyboard features of this tool. It can be integrated with other IBM tools.  

Conclusion: If you are looking forward to implementing test automation for your specific project, get connected with a premium software testing services company that will provide professional consultation and support on developing a crystal-clear automation strategy. Based on your project scope and budget, our team will also let you know which test automation tool will be the most feasible and cost-effective for attaining your project-specific goals.

License: You have permission to republish this article in any format, even commercially, but you must keep all links intact. Attribution required.